概括
心力衰竭 (HF) 和额头膜疾病 (MVD) 在性别,种族和社会经济地位上存在差异. 女性和黑人患者面临治疗延迟和利用不足,影响治疗结果.

背景情况:
- 心力衰竭 (HF) 是一个全球性的健康问题,通常与关病 (MVD) 相关.
- 多发性疾病既可以是高频率的原因,也可以是高频率的后果,其流行率和病因因因人口统计学而言各不相同.
- 性别,种族,种族和社会经济地位 (SES) 等因素显著影响HF患者的MVD.

主要成果:
- 在MVD患病率,治疗和与HF相关的结果中发现了显著的差异.
- 女性和黑人患者的治疗不足和护理延迟的风险更高,往往在晚期出现.
- 男人和白人患者被确定为治疗不足和不良结果风险较低的组.
- 低SES与风湿性心脏病和HF风险增加有关,导致二次MR的发生.
结论:
- 目前对与HF相关的MVD的护理表现出重大不平等.
- 解决MVD治疗指南和健康的社会决定因素对于最大限度地减少差异至关重要.
- 需要进一步的研究和资金来提高认识,并改善所有患者群体的治疗结果.

Heart failure (HF) is a progressive syndrome involving ventricles that leads to inadequate cardiac output. It can be classified based on location and output or ejection fraction. Ejection fraction (EF) is an essential measurement in the diagnosis and surveillance of HF. Reduced EF corresponds to systolic heart failure (HFrEF). The heart's primary function is to pump blood throughout the body, maintaining a balance between blood sent out (cardiac output) and blood returning (venous return). If this balance is disrupted, it can result in congestive heart failure (CHF), a severe condition where the heart becomes an inefficient pump, leading to inadequate blood circulation.

The human heart is a complex organ with an intricate system of valves that regulate blood flow. There are two main types of valves: atrioventricular (AV) valves and semilunar valves.
The AV valves prevent the backflow of blood from the ventricles to the atria during ventricular contraction. These valves function with the assistance of the chordae tendineae and papillary muscles. Auscultation, an essential part of a heart examination, is done using a stethoscope. It provides crucial information about heart function and possible heart problems. Due to heart problems, abnormal sounds can be heard during systole or diastole. These sounds include S3 and S4 gallops, opening snaps, systolic clicks, and murmurs.
